Cryoskin is a non-invasive body contouring and fat reduction treatment that uses controlled cooling to target and eliminate fat cells. While it can be an effective option, it's important to ensure the safety and quality of the procedure, especially when done in a new location.
When it comes to the safety of Cryoskin in Chicago, there are a few key factors to consider. Firstly, it's crucial to ensure that the clinic or spa offering the treatment is licensed and operated by qualified professionals. In Illinois, medical aesthetic procedures like Cryoskin should be performed by licensed medical professionals, such as physicians, physician assistants, or nurse practitioners, to ensure the highest standards of care and safety.
Additionally, it's important to research the clinic's reputation and read reviews from previous clients. Look for a facility that has a track record of providing safe and effective treatments, with a focus on patient satisfaction and positive outcomes. Be wary of any clinics that make unrealistic promises or claims, as this could be a red flag for substandard practices.
Another important aspect to consider is the equipment and technology used for the Cryoskin treatment. Reputable clinics should use FDA-approved devices that have been rigorously tested for safety and efficacy. The technicians performing the treatment should also be highly trained and experienced in using the equipment properly to minimize the risk of complications or adverse effects.
Furthermore, it's essential to have a thorough consultation with the healthcare provider before undergoing the Cryoskin procedure. They should assess your medical history, discuss the potential risks and benefits, and ensure that you are a suitable candidate for the treatment. They should also provide detailed instructions on how to prepare for the procedure and what to expect during and after the treatment.
